Psychological Perspective

Psychologically, this experience can be explained through various frameworks. It might stem from a rich inner life, where imagination and fantasy are strong, leading to vivid interpretations of everyday experiences or dreams. The human mind is capable of filling in gaps with information, creating a narrative that aligns with deeply felt emotions or beliefs. If someone has a strong belief in spirit communication, their brain might process ambiguous stimuli (like a sudden warmth, a recurring dream, or a feeling of presence) as a message from the deceased. Furthermore, grief can heighten suggestibility and emotional sensitivity, making it easier to perceive connections that might not objectively exist. It could also be linked to heightened empathy, intuition, or even dissociation, where the individual separates from their immediate reality to access deeper emotional or psychic layers.
